1967 Rickenbacker 366
Call
Well Strung Guitars
Get a 6-string or 12-string sound with this nicely aged 1967 Rickenbacker 366 in its original Fireglo finish! The idea behind this model and its nifty converter, nicknamed “the Comb,” was that you could switch back and forth between a 6 or 12-string configuration at any time using the converter...
1964 Rickenbacker Rose Morris Model 1996
Call
Well Strung Guitars
Check out this beautiful 1964 Rickenbacker 1996 Rose Morris in Fireglo! Rose Morris out of London was Rickenbacker’s UK distributor, and in 1963, they commissioned six models specifically for sale to the Beatlemania-driven British market. Each model closely resembled Rickenbacker’s traditional line...
